CG Net and Thulo.com sign strategic partnership to boost SME digitalization and automation in Nepal

काठमाडौं ।

CG Net and Thulo.com have signed a strategic partnership agreement aimed at accelerating SME digital transformation in Nepal by making
modern business tools more accessible for small and medium-sized enterprises across the country.

The agreement was signed by Mr. Sujan Thapa, CEO of CG Net, and Mr. Raja Ram Nepal, CEO of Thulo.com. The partnership focuses on helping SMEs adopt structured digital systems that improve day-to-day operations, customer handling, sales follow-ups, marketing
communication, and overall productivity—reducing manual work and enabling faster, more sustainable growth.

Commenting on the collaboration, Mr. Thapa said CG Net is focused on enabling Nepal’s digital future and sees the partnership as a practical way to help SMEs adopt modern tools. “By combining reliable connectivity and strong digital solutions, we can help businesses across
Nepal adopt modern systems and operate more efficiently,” he said.

Mr. Raja Ram Nepal, CEO of Thulo.com, said the partnership is designed to remove common barriers that many small businesses face when shifting from manual processes to digital operations.

“Small businesses are the backbone of Nepal’s economy, but many still
struggle with scattered processes and manual work. This partnership with CG Net is an important step to make business automation easier and more accessible for SMEs,” he said. “Together, we aim to help Nepali businesses save time, manage customers better, increase sales efficiency, and grow with confidence through digital tools.”

The service under this partnership is currently available in Kathmandu Valley, Pokhara, and Chitwan, and will be expanded to other cities across Nepal soon, enabling wider SME adoption of business automation tools beyond major urban centers.

Both companies believe this collaboration will create a major milestone in Nepal’s SME ecosystem by encouraging faster adoption of digital business tools and improving how small businesses manage customers, sales, marketing, and internal operations in an increasingly
digital economy.
